Product Specific Information

1 µg/mL of MA5-27706 was sufficient for detection of HSP22 in 20 µg of whole rat tissue extract by ECL immunoblot analysis using Goat anti-mouse IgG:HRP as the secondary antibody. Detects approximately 22 kDa. Detects endogenous and exogenous HSP22 in monomeric, dimeric, and tetrameric forms in WB. Does not cross-react with alpha crystallin.

Target Information

The protein encoded by this gene belongs to the superfamily of small heat-shock proteins containing a conserved alpha-crystallin domain at the C-terminal part of the molecule. Expression of this gene is induced by estrogen in estrogen receptor-positive breast cancer cells. This protein functions as a chaperone in association with Bag3, a stimulator of macroautophagy. It is involved in regulation of cell proliferation, apoptosis, and carcinogenesis. Mutations in this gene have been associated with neuromuscular diseases including Charcot-Marie-Tooth disease.
